    Experience the Unspoiled Beauty and Warmth of Douglas, Wyoming

    In the heart of Wyoming, Douglas effortlessly blends small-town charm with breathtaking natural beauty. Known for its welcoming community, Douglas offers a delightful quality of life where neighbors often become lifelong friends. Whether you're looking for a peaceful retreat or a place to raise a family, this town is unparalleled in its offerings. With the North Platte River meandering gracefully through the town, outdoor enthusiasts revel in activities like fishing, kayaking, and hiking along the picturesque trails. The mesmerizing open skies present an enchanting canvas for stargazers, making every night a celestial event. For those with an adventurous spirit, the nearby Medicine Bow National Forest provides a haven for exploration with its vast landscapes and diverse wildlife. History buffs will find Douglas fascinating, with its rich railroad and pioneer history proudly displayed at the Wyoming Pioneer Memorial Museum. The town celebrates its heritage with local events like the annual Wyoming State Fair, which attracts visitors from all corners of the state. Douglas takes pride in its education and community initiatives, nurturing a supportive environment for growth and creativity. With a strong agricultural base and emerging business opportunities, Douglas is not just a place to live—it's a place to thrive. Come for the views, stay for the vibrant community spirit.

    Community Spirit Shines Bright in Douglas, Wyoming!

    Douglas, Wyoming, is a beacon of community spirit and collaboration, thanks to a network of vibrant community organizations that energize this charming town. These groups are the lifeblood of Douglas, fostering connections and helping to ensure everyone feels like they belong. At the heart of Douglas's community initiatives is the Douglas Community Club, which organizes everything from local clean-up campaigns to spirited town fairs that enchant residents and visitors alike. Their dedication to creating a welcoming environment is matched by the commendable initiatives of the local Food Pantry, ensuring that no one in Douglas goes without a hot meal or a friendly face. The spirit of giving back continues to flourish with the efforts of the Douglas Volunteer Fire Department. Their commitment goes beyond emergency response – they engage with the community through educational programs and festive events that highlight safety and teamwork. Meanwhile, heritage comes to life with the Converse County Historical Society, which breathes new life into local history, fostering pride and preserving the stories of Douglas for future generations to cherish. Together, these organizations make Douglas not just a town, but a thriving hub of community warmth and generosity. Their dedication transforms the town into a tapestry of kindness, proving that in Douglas, caring and community go hand in hand.
